The recent string of burglaries targeting eyeglass shops in central Phoenix has sparked concern among local business owners as well as legal experts. Over the course of one week, multiple stores—such as Central Eyeworks and Village Eye Works—suffered early morning break-ins that resulted in significant property and inventory loss. In these incidents, perpetrators not only damaged storefronts by hurling objects like boulders through windows but also meticulously targeted valuable eyewear inventory, particularly high-end sunglasses.

Phoenix Eyewear Shop Thefts: Examining the Evidence and Police Response

According to reports, security footage from affected businesses has provided law enforcement with crucial insights into the methods of the burglary. For instance, at Central Eyeworks, owner Tommy Libert recounted how a boulder was used to shatter a window, allowing the intruder to gain access during the quiet early hours. Similarly, Village Eye Works, a longstanding establishment since the 1980s, was subject to a swift and efficient looting process where valuables were stuffed into a pillowcase.

The Phoenix police have since been actively seeking any witnesses or individuals who might recognize the suspect from the footage. Although no arrests have been made at this stage, the investigation continues amid efforts to piece together what might be an interconnected series of burglaries. Authorities suspect a possible link between the incidents given the geographic closeness and similar modus operandi, yet they are cautious in drawing definitive conclusions without gathering further evidence.
